Why Aging Teeth React Differently to Fillings:

As we age, our teeth—like the rest of our body—undergo natural changes. While fillings are designed to be minimally invasive, the aging pulp and surrounding structures are often less tolerant to stress. For older adults, a simple filling can sometimes lead to nerve inflammation, resulting in prolonged pain or the need for more extensive treatment like root canal therapy.


Key Changes in the Aging Tooth:

  1. Pulp Shrinkage and CalcificationWith age, the pulp chamber within the tooth becomes smaller and more calcified. This reduces the space for nerves and blood vessels and increases the risk of inflammation when dental work is performed.

  2. Diminished Healing CapacityThe reduced blood supply in older adults makes it harder for the tooth to recover from even minor trauma caused by drilling or decay removal.

  3. Thinner EnamelYears of wear and tear erode the enamel, leaving teeth more sensitive and susceptible to stress during procedures.

  4. More Extensive RestorationsMany older adults have had multiple dental treatments over their lifetime. These repeat interventions can strain the tooth structure and heighten the risk of post-treatment complications.

Post-Filling Inflammation: Why It Matters More in Seniors:

Post-filling inflammation occurs when the inner pulp of the tooth becomes irritated, either from the procedure itself or from pre-existing deep decay. While it may resolve on its own in younger patients, it often lingers in older adults and may evolve into chronic pulpitis or infection.


Common Symptoms After a Filling:

  • Persistent sensitivity to hot, cold, or sweet stimuli

  • Throbbing or pulsating pain, especially at night

  • Discomfort while chewing

  • Swelling or tenderness around the gum line

If these symptoms persist, they may indicate the need for a nerve filling, also known as root canal therapy.

How Root Canal Therapy Benefits Older Adults:

When inflammation in the pulp becomes irreversible, a nerve filling is often the best course of action. For seniors, preserving natural teeth is crucial to maintaining oral function and avoiding the complications of dentures or implants.


Advantages of Root Canal in Seniors:

  • Pain Relief: Eliminates chronic sensitivity and discomfort

  • Tooth Preservation: Retains the natural tooth structure and avoids extraction

  • Improved Chewing Ability: Maintains bite efficiency, important for proper nutrition

  • Better Oral Hygiene: Easier to clean natural teeth than to manage gaps or prosthetics

  • Lower Infection Risk: Removes the infected pulp and seals the canals, preventing further issues

With the right specialist, the procedure can be quick, comfortable, and tailored to the needs of older adults.

Preventing Post-Filling Inflammation in Seniors:

While not every case of nerve inflammation can be prevented, certain strategies significantly reduce the risk in aging patients.


Proactive Measures Include:

  • Early Detection of Decay: Regular dental check-ups help catch cavities before they reach the nerve.

  • Gentle Treatment Approaches: Minimally invasive techniques and use of desensitizing agents help protect the pulp.

  • Proper Bite Adjustment: Ensuring the filling is not too high prevents excess pressure on aging teeth.

  • Close Monitoring: Follow-ups allow the dentist to assess healing and detect signs of inflammation early.

  • Hydration and Nutrition: A balanced diet and sufficient water intake support oral tissue health.

1. Why are older adults more prone to nerve inflammation after a filling?

As people age, their tooth pulp shrinks and becomes less resilient. This, combined with prior dental work and thinner enamel, makes them more vulnerable to inflammation after restorative procedures.


2. What is a nerve filling, and when is it needed?

A nerve filling, also known as root canal therapy, is required when the pulp inside the tooth becomes inflamed or infected. It involves removing the damaged pulp, cleaning the canals, and sealing the tooth.


3. Is root canal therapy safe for seniors?

Yes, with modern techniques and experienced specialists, root canal therapy is both safe and effective for older adults. It helps relieve pain and preserve natural teeth.


4. How do I know if I need a nerve filling after a dental filling?

If pain persists beyond a few weeks, is triggered by hot or cold foods, or causes spontaneous throbbing, it may be a sign of pulp inflammation requiring root canal treatment.


5. Can the inflammation go away on its own?

In minor cases, irritation may resolve naturally. However, chronic or worsening symptoms should be evaluated by a dentist promptly to avoid more serious complications.
